Victorian Servants
60 mins, KS1
Preston Manor & Gardens 

The year is 1897, and Brighton’s most famous Manor House has opened its doors to… A School for Servants!

Your class will step into the past and learn what it was like to work for a wealthy family in Victorian times.

There’s lots to do – polish silver, make beds, grind spices, sweep floors, beat rugs and much more. It’s hard work, and Mr Beesley, the butler, needs keen, cheerful servants who aren’t afraid to get busy!

Allergy Information – Activities include

  • Children will grate/grind mustard seeds, coriander seeds, dried cloves, nutmeg, black peppercorns.
  • Children will weigh wheat-free macaroni.
  • Children will handle dried lavender and rose petals.
  • Educator will demonstrate with lemon juice and bicarbonate of soda.

Decolonising

  • We introduce the British Empire and that the Victorians took many resources from Colonies.
  • We show examples of people of colour in Victorian Brighton, such as Aina of the Yoruba people, and prominent musicians and sports people.
